Job Description: CNC Programmer

We are seeking a skilled CNC Programmer to create CNC programs and part drawings for various machine parts and tools, including CNC lathes and machining centers. This role involves offline programming using MasterCAM and Solidworks software. The position offers long-term potential for growth and the flexibility to work from home at times.

Responsibilities

  • Create CNC programs and part drawings for various machine parts and tools for multiple machine types, including CNC lathes and machining centers.
  • Provide testing and troubleshooting of programs upon completion.
  • Perform offline programming away from the machine in the office on the computer.
  • Collaborate with the engineering team and report to the Engineering Lead Programmer.

Essential Skills

  • One year or more of CNC Machine – Programming Experience, setup, and operation experience (Haas Machinery / Fanuc Controls).
  • Knowledge of Drawing Standards, including concepts like geometric tolerancing, surface finishes, etc.
  • Strong familiarity with MasterCAM X-Series of software, specifically versions used for offline programming.
  • Strong familiarity with Solidworks CAD software, specifically 2017 versions.
  • Familiarity with machining toolpaths, setups, and work holding.
